GREETINGS!

Community Editor, The Observer

NEW SMYRNA BEACH, April 26, 2002 - The final play of the current season (2001-2002) at the Little Theatre of New Smyrna Beach opens at 8 a.m. this evening.

This heart-warming comedy takes a look at the Gorski family. Andy Gorski, played by Jerry Thomas, has a sweet Catholic mother, a sour Catholic father and a severely retarded younger brother.

Don Campbell plays Phil Gorski, the sour father, Pauline Rodick plays his sweet wife, Emily, and Spencer Meehl plays the retarded brother, Mickey.

When Andy brings home Randi Stein, his Jewish atheist fiancé, played by Valerie Goodfellow, to meet the folks on Christmas Eve, his worst fears about family blow-ups are realized.

But it is right in the middle of the explosion that Mickey, whose entire vocabulary thus far has been Oh, Boy and Wow, suddenly says Greetings! and initiates a wild and hilarious exploration into the nature of earthly reality. Mickey has loaned his body to an ancient, wise and witty spirit (Lucius) who is set upon healing the family.

This is a wonderful play about love, family, faith, and miracles. Nancy McCormick is the director and Estie Keyes is stage manager.

Production Coordinator is Jane Taylor. Bill Roehrborn is Technical Director and Mary Monnier is Set Decorator.

Camille Dickinson is in charge of props, Rose Dingas is handling costumes, and Debbi Zill does lights and sound.
